Annual Returns
As filed with the Charity Commission for England and Wales. Most recent filing covers the financial year ending 2025.
| Financial Year | Income | Expenditure | Charitable Spending | Net Assets | Reserves | Staff |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2025 | £9,484,000 | £8,837,000 | £7,008,000 | £10,155,000 | £3,879,000 | 75 / 1 |
| 2024 | £12,275,000 | £8,063,000 | £6,453,000 | £9,081,000 | £4,652,000 | 77 / 1 |
| 2023 | £7,133,000 | £6,880,000 | £5,832,000 | £6,082,000 | £3,053,000 | 77 / 1 |
| 2022 | £5,351,000 | £6,317,000 | £5,274,000 | £6,737,000 | £6,647,000 | 75 / 1 |
| 2021 | £7,505,000 | £7,421,000 | £6,573,000 | £4,897,000 | £3,757,000 | 88 / 1 |
Staff column shows: Employees / Volunteers
Frequently asked questions about The National Council For Voluntary Organisations
What does The National Council For Voluntary Organisations do?
NCVO champions the voluntary sector and volunteering. We connect, represent and support voluntary organisations.
How much income did The National Council For Voluntary Organisations report in 2025?
The National Council For Voluntary Organisations reported total income of £9.48m and reported expenditure of £8.84m for the financial year ending 2025, based on the most recent annual return filed with the Charity Commission.
How efficient is The National Council For Voluntary Organisations?
The National Council For Voluntary Organisations has a program ratio of 73.9%, meaning that share of its income goes directly to charitable activities. This is higher than 25% of UK Charity and VCS support charities with income £1M to £10M (sample of 520 charities). See our methodology for how this is calculated.
When was The National Council For Voluntary Organisations registered as a charity?
The National Council For Voluntary Organisations was registered with the Charity Commission for England and Wales on 1 January 1964 as charity number 225922. It has been registered for 62 years.
Who runs The National Council For Voluntary Organisations?
The National Council For Voluntary Organisations is governed by a board of 10 trustees. The chair of trustees is Priya Singh. Trustees are legally responsible for the charity's governance and are listed in full on its profile.
Where does The National Council For Voluntary Organisations operate?
The National Council For Voluntary Organisations operates in England, as recorded in its Charity Commission filing.
Is The National Council For Voluntary Organisations a registered charity?
Yes — The National Council For Voluntary Organisations is a registered charity in England and Wales, charity number 225922.
